Q3-C- The 304 stainless steel shaft with modulus of rigidity 75 GPa and 3 m long has an outer diameter of 60 mm. When it is rotating at 60 rad/s, it transmits 30 kW of power from the engine E to the generator G. Determine the smallest thickness of the shaft if the allowable 150 MPa., and the shaft is restricted not to twist more than 0.08 rad. shear stress Tallow
